Two-input wallplate transmitter for digital and analog AV

The XTP T UWP 302 from Extron Electronics can be deployed in locations including floor boxes and lecterns.

The XTP T UWP 302, a two-input wallplate transmitter from Extron Electronics, provides the capability to connect local source devices at a wall or other locations, including a lectern or floor box, the company says. The transmitter mounts into a standard three-gang junction box and sends HDMI or RGBHV video, audio and control up to 100 meters over a single Category cable. Extron points out the wallplate transmitter is HDCP-compliant and supports computer-video to 1920x1200, including HDTV 1080p/60 Deep Color and 2K. “For simplified integration,” the company explains, “the XTP T UWP 302 features automatic switching between inputs with selectable prioritization, and can be powered over the same Cat X cable. The XTP T UWP 302 is designed for use in XTP Systems for signal distribution and long-distance transmission between remote endpoints.”

Casey Hall, Extron’s vice president of sales and marketing, commented, “This wallplate transmitter for XTP Systems enables easy AV access for guest presenters or when bringing in temporary sources. The XTP T UWP 302 transmitter offers the flexibility to accept digital or analog signals, in a discreet wall or furniture installation.”
